What You\'ll Do
As an Accountant within our Financial Accounting team, you\'ll be responsible for preparing accounting and financial reporting information for the Group to meet stakeholder, regulatory, and management needs.
You\'ll ensure compliance with accounting standards and legislation while supporting various financial processes across the organisation.
Key Responsibilities
Prepare annual and half-yearly financial statements for the consolidated group and subsidiaries
Liaise with internal and external auditors and provide required reports
Perform month-end accounting entries and reconciliations
Support fixed asset and project accounting, including capitalisation
Administer revenue metering systems and reconcile Energy Clearing House transactions
Prepare and submit Crown financial reporting via CFIS and respond to Treasury queries
